I bought a lightscribe (can laser pictures/titles onto a DVD rather than using a sticky label) DVD burner this morning which I have now installed and works perfectly. However my monitor now wont turn on! I have put an old monitor on the computer and this one works fine. My monitor was working fine last night - why won't it work now?! I have a compaq computer and have checked all the connections which appear fine and not lose. There is no power light at all - the screnn just stays blank/black. Can anyone help?

It sounds as though your monitor may have burned out of have a loose connection somewhere. (Maybe within the cord, where you can't touch it.) Installing a new DVD burner wouldn't affect the display of your monitor. Even if you installed a new video card driver, it wouldn't make your screen go blank - it would just change how it displays images. If another monitor worked with the same system, it sounds as though your monitor just coincidentally died when you installed your DVD burner.

Try the broken monitor with another computer to double check, if you want. Sounds as though you might need to buy a new monitor, or stick with that old one... =\
